Vallabhi

Vallabhi (modern Vala) is an ancient city on the Saurashtra peninsula of Gujarat in western India, near Bhavnagar. It was the capital of the ancient Maitraka dynasty.

Legend has it that a Rajput named Vijayasen founded the city around the 3rd century. The Maitrakas, descended from a Gupta general, ruled Saurashtra and parts of southern Rajasthan from Vallabhi from the sixth to the eighth centuries. Vallabhi was a Jain center, and the Maitrakas may have been Jains. Maitraka rule was ended with the sacking of Vallabhi by Arab armies in 770.
